In this country, neonatal circumcisions are usually performed without any consideration of the pain the newborn endures. A simple easy‐to‐learn technique of superficial dorsal penile nerve‐block procedure was employed on 109 infants. This technique does not increase circumcision morbidity and ought to be employed before neonatal circumcision, so that they may benefit from the practice of modern anesthesia.
